Сообщение Re[5]: Placement new для инициализации примитивного типа в с от 03.10.2025 12:38
Изменено 03.10.2025 12:39 andrey.desman
Re[5]: Placement new для инициализации примитивного типа в самодельном union?
Здравствуйте, so5team, Вы писали:
S>Однако, как я понимаю, тогда работа будет выглядеть как-то так:
Создать объект надо один раз. В сторе должно быть создание (через new или sla), а в read просто reinterpret_cast.
Но раз в сторе всё равно запись делается, то толку от sla и нет.
S>Есть ощущение, что вариант с placement new окажется и лаконичнее, и понятнее.
Да.
S>Однако, как я понимаю, тогда работа будет выглядеть как-то так:
Создать объект надо один раз. В сторе должно быть создание (через new или sla), а в read просто reinterpret_cast.
Но раз в сторе всё равно запись делается, то толку от sla и нет.
S>Есть ощущение, что вариант с placement new окажется и лаконичнее, и понятнее.
Да.
Re[5]: Placement new для инициализации примитивного типа в с
Здравствуйте, so5team, Вы писали:
S>Однако, как я понимаю, тогда работа будет выглядеть как-то так:
Создать объект надо один раз. В сторе должно быть создание (через new или sla), а в read просто reinterpret_cast.
Но раз в сторе всё равно запись делается, то толку от sla и нет.
В общем, как у тебя было изначально, так и хорошо.
S>Есть ощущение, что вариант с placement new окажется и лаконичнее, и понятнее.
Да.
S>Однако, как я понимаю, тогда работа будет выглядеть как-то так:
Создать объект надо один раз. В сторе должно быть создание (через new или sla), а в read просто reinterpret_cast.
Но раз в сторе всё равно запись делается, то толку от sla и нет.
В общем, как у тебя было изначально, так и хорошо.
S>Есть ощущение, что вариант с placement new окажется и лаконичнее, и понятнее.
Да.